Beyond Radio was delighted to support a quiz night to raise funds for North West Air Ambulance Charity.
The event, organised by Halton company Like Technologies and held at Lancaster Brewery on February 9, raised £2,322.25 for the charity to help them fly to save lives.
The quiz night was hosted by Beyond Radio's Greg Lambert with live music from singer Leah Silva, and was won by the SquizMasters from SQ Digital, who won tickets to the Brewery's Fruhlingsfest this weekend!
Like Technologies thanked Greg and Leah, and the people and businesses that donated raffle prizes.
North West Air Ambulance Charity receives no government or NHS funding and needs to raise over £9.5 million each year.
Their helicopters and response vehicles operate 365 days a year, with highly skilled specialist doctors and paramedics on board to provide enhanced pre-hospital care and hospital transfers to patients across the entire North-West - that’s 5,500 square miles with a population of over eight million people.
